First Kiss to Last Breath( Pop Song)

Verse 1:
That summer night beneath the Georgia pines
Your lips found mine for the very first time
Lightning struck and the whole world changed
Nothing’s ever been the same

The way you whispered my name so low
Set my restless heart on fire
In that moment I just knew
You’re all I’ll ever desire

Chorus:
From our first kiss to our last breath
This love will see us through
When the storms come and the road gets rough
My heart belongs to you
Through the years that lie ahead of us
One thing will always be true
From our first kiss to our last breath
I’m gonna love you

Verse 2:
Every morning when I wake up
To your body next to mine
I remember what forever feels like
In the dancing morning light

When you touch me like you do
When you hold me close and tight
Baby, you’re my everything
My reason and my why

Chorus:
From our first kiss to our last breath
This love will see us through
When the storms come and the road gets rough
My heart belongs to you
Through the years that lie ahead of us
One thing will always be true
From our first kiss to our last breath
I’m gonna love you

Bridge:
Time may change us, life may test us
But this fire burns so deep
In your arms I’ve found my home
A promise that we’ll always keep

Final Chorus:
From our first kiss to our last breath
This love will see us through
When the storms come and the road gets rough
My heart belongs to you
Through whatever lies ahead of us
One thing will always be true
From our first kiss to our last breath
I’m gonna love you
Yeah, from our first kiss to our last breath
I’m gonna love you

Musical arrangement would feature acoustic guitar, steel guitar, and a building rhythm section with intimate verses and soaring choruses typical of country pop style.
